Welcome to ns-vue-vite-demo! This application helps you create Vue apps effortlessly using Vite. Even if you're new to programming, you can follow these simple steps to get started.
Before you begin, make sure your system meets these requirements:
- Operating System: Windows 10 or later, macOS 10.14 or later, or a recent Linux distribution.
- A modern web browser (Chrome, Firefox, Safari).
- At least 4 GB of RAM.
- A stable internet connection for downloading files.

Once youβve installed ns-vue-vite-demo, follow these steps to create your first Vue app:
- Open the application.
- Select "Create New Project" from the main menu.
- Enter your project name and choose a location to save.
- Click "Create" and wait for the setup to complete.
- Once done, you can start adding your components and making your app unique.
